Deformation Behavior of Carbon Fiber/Al Composites with Corrugated Structure for Developing the Rolling Plate

Herein, a rolling strategy for carbon fiber (CF)/Al composites is proposed, that is, by constructing a corrugated structure of Sn-protected CFs ([CF@Sn]& AP;Al composites), to realize the cooperative extension of woven CFs with Al matrix deformation in the rolling process. The matching extension feasibility and structural optimization of (CF@Sn]& AP;Al composites are calculated based on the designed 3D numerical model of rolling system. The [CF@Sn]& AP;Al composites have successfully combined excellent mechanical properties while meeting the extension design of the CF reinforcement. Mechanical testing of the samples indicates that the tensile strength of the [CF@Sn]& AP;Al composites increases by 18.6% while the bending strength is more than 23.2% higher than that of the rolled Al matrix. The present work provides an effective method for developing the deformed CF/Al composites as rolling plate in lightweight applications.
